Portugal lead South Korea after an early goal from Ricardo Horta.

Manchester United full-back Diogo Dalot is making his World Cup debut and 5 minutes into the game, he was responsible for assisting the opening goal as Portugal look set to top their group.

It was a poor goal for South Korea to concede. Pepe played a long diagonal ball from deep down towards the right wing for Dalot to chase. He controlled it wonderfully before cutting inside. His pull-back allowed Horta to volley home from close range.

This means an already difficult task for South Korea has been made more difficult. They only have themselves to blame but we’re happy for Dalot.

Dalot could earn his way into the Portugal starting XI for the knockout stages at this rate. He has now been directly involved in four goals across his last three appearances for Portugal in all competitions (2 goals, 2 assists), as per Opta Joe.
